Lutheran High School North provides the opportunity for students from around the globe to attend a college prep, Christian High School. Lutheran North graduates are provided the opportunity to be prepared to go on to the colleges of their choice. Each year 96+ percent of graduates go on to the colleges of their choice. An outstanding college counseling department prepares each student to make the best choices for their college choice and guides them in scholarship searches.
Lutheran North provides a full service experience that includes home stay placement, health insurance and more. If you are concerned that your English proficiency may not meet the standards of Lutheran North, we have opportunities to assist you with that need.
